Wiki/Biography

Anuradha Paudwal was born as Alka Nadkarni on 27 October 1954 (age 66 years; as in 2018) in Karwar, Bombay State (now Karnataka), India. He did his graduation from St. Xavier’s College, Mumbai. He claims to have never had any musical training; Her mother sent her to a local music school where she learned valuable singing lessons. She also received training at various places but was unsuccessful in the process. She made Lata Mangeshkar her guru and started practicing for hours following Lata ji’s notes. Family, Caste and Husband

He was born in a Konkani family in Uttara Kannada, Karnataka, India, but brought up in Mumbai. She belonged to a family where singing was considered taboo. His father was completely against his singing. However, his mother supported his talent and sent him to a local music school to learn singing. She is married to the late Arun Paudwal, who was a musician.

livelihood

SD Burman offered him a song in the 1973 Hindi film ‘Abhiman’, which was a Shiva shloka.

In the same year, she made her film debut with ‘Yashoda’. In 1974, he released a record of the Marathi song “Bhav Geetan” which became very popular. He got his first success from the film Kalicharan (1976).

His first solo film was in Aap Beeti. He also sang for various composers like Rajesh Roshan, Jai-Dev, Kalyanji-Anandji and others. She is known for her songs in Bollywood films Hero (1983), Meri Jung (1985), Batwara (1989), Nagina (1986) and Ram Lakhan (1989). After reaching the peak of her career in Bollywood, she announced that she would sing only for T-Series. She then started her career as a devotional singer; Earned a lot of fame and popularity. She returned to sing for Bollywood again, but her comeback received only a small audience. He continued singing devotional songs and released several music albums, which have become his speciality. He has also sung songs in other languages ​​which include Kannada, Marwari, Marathi, Bengali, Tamil, Punjabi and many more.

controversies

  • She once challenged legendary playback singer Lata Mangeshkar and claimed to record the most number of songs in a single day. She also challenged the monopoly of the Mangeshkar sisters in the film industry.
  • She dubbed Alka Yagnik’s songs and later dubbed Lata Mangeshkar’s songs and claimed that her voice suited the film’s actress better.
  • In January 2020, a 45-year-old woman named Karmala Modex from Kerala claimed that she was the daughter of Anuradha Paudwal. She told media persons that the singer had left her with her foster parents Ponnachan and Agnes; Soon after his birth in 1974. Karmala also revealed that she had filed a petition before the district family court in Thiruvananthapuram to establish the fact that she is Paudwal’s legal daughter.

fact

  • She says that her interest in music started when she heard a song by Lata Mangeshkar.
  • Her career with T-Series earned her the nickname “T-Series Queen”.

  • According to Anuradha Paudwal, in her childhood she often dreamed of seeing Lata Mangeshkar singing live.
  • He once told that originally his voice was hoarse.
  • She once suffered from an attack of pneumonia so severe that she almost completely lost her voice. After being bedridden for over a month, he found solace in the voice of Lata Mangeshkar.
  • On the hospital bed, she used to listen to “Bhagwat Geeta” in Lata Mangeshkar’s voice which was gifted to her by one of her uncles. After recovery, his voice had completely changed. Later, he worked on toning his voice.
  • She considered Lata ji as her guru and gave her all the credit for her success. He said that he was trained by many gurus, but Lata ji was his inspiration. “It’s like an institution,” she says.

  • He participated in many events of his school and college and won many awards. First of all he won for Lata ji’s Meera Bhajan.
  • He was even rejected at one such school festival, where the comment was made, “Voice unfit for smooth music.”
  • She fell in love with Arun Paudwal when she was a teenager. Due to Arun’s association with the music industry, his father did not initially approve of their marriage, as show business was considered taboo.
  • At the age of 17, she was married to Arun Paudwal, who was 10 years older than her.
  • Arun Paudwal always encouraged him to sing. He was his close mentor and critic.
  • She says that it was difficult for her to enter the industry even through connections. He was told that there was no room for devotional songs in the market. This inspired him to create his first Marathi devotional album.
  • Once Arun got him a recording of Lataji. He listened to it very attentively and after that, sang the songs from the same recording in “Yuva Vani”, a very popular Gujarati program which was heard by many people. Laxmikant-Pyarelal, Hridaynath Mangeshkar and many top musicians began a quest to find the man behind the sound. It took them a while to figure out that it was Alka Nadkarni (Anuradha Paudwal’s maiden name). Ultimately, it was SD Burman who gave Anuradha her first break.
  • When Abhimana released, around 25 to 30 members of Anuradha’s family went to the Plaza Theater to see Anuradha’s name in the credits.
  • She won her first major film award for the song “Mera Mann Baje Mridang…”, however, she was expecting the award for the song “Tu Mera Jaanu Hai” from the film Hero.

  • “Tu Mera Jaanu Hai” from the film Hero was earlier assigned to Lata Mangeshkar. However, when Anuradha went to the studio to dub the song, the composers liked it so much that they kept her version of the track in the film.
  • Anuradha Paudwal was the signature singer in most of Subhash Ghai’s films. The Gayatri Mantra sung by him is still a part of the Mukta Kala symbol.
  • She has also sung the song “Gumsum Si Khoi Khoi” from the film Badalte Rishtey (1978) with legendary singer Kishore Kumar.

  • In the 1990s, she became the voice of Madhuri Dixit. The song “Bahut Pyaar Karte Hain Tumko Sanam” struggled to remain in the charts for a long time.
  • She had a very good bonding with T-Series king Gulshan Kumar. When he was shot dead in August 1997, his perspective on success changed. She says,

    Today, when I get a hit, it feels good, but that’s it. ,

  • After her husband’s death, Anuradha’s son, Aditya, also entered the world of music and became one of the youngest composers in the Indian film industry. His daughter Kavita is also a playback singer.
  • She runs the “Suryoday” Foundation in the memory of her late husband Arun.
  • Along with Gulshan Kumar, he was instrumental in bringing forward many unknown playback singers including Udit Narayan, Sonu Nigam, Kumar Sanu and Abhijeet.
  • When she started her journey as a singer, people predicted that she would replace Lata Mangeshkar. Even veteran musician OP Nayyar had commented that Lata had finished and Anuradha had finished her. But he cleared it all by saying that he never wanted for the moon, he is satisfied with what his audience and the music industry has given him. He always felt that it was better to retire from the summit, “Vrana log darwaja dikha deta hain (Otherwise you are shown the doors)”
  • She has deep faith in Baba Mahakal (Mahakaleshwar Temple, Ujjain) and often visits the temple.
  • She has a desire to record poetry and wants to record the compositions of Shankaracharya.
